Introduction

The TPS40303DRCR is a voltage mode synchronous buck controller belonging to the category of power management integrated circuits (PMICs). This device is commonly used in various applications such as point-of-load regulation, server and telecom power supplies, and industrial power systems. The TPS40303DRCR is known for its high efficiency, compact package, and robust performance, making it a popular choice for power supply designs.

Specifications

  • Input Voltage Range: 4.5V to 28V
  • Output Voltage Range: 0.6V to 5.5V
  • Switching Frequency: Adjustable up to 1.5MHz
  • Operating Temperature Range: -40°C to 125°C
  • Features: Overcurrent protection, thermal shutdown, adjustable soft start, power good indicator

Working Principles

The TPS40303DRCR operates based on the voltage mode control technique, where the feedback voltage is compared with a reference to regulate the output voltage. The synchronous rectification mechanism minimizes power losses, while the adjustable switching frequency allows flexibility in design. The device incorporates overcurrent protection and thermal shutdown to ensure safe and reliable operation.
